3. penampil dotmatriks

5

Click here to load reader

Upload: likno

Post on 12-Jun-2015

146 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: 3. Penampil Dotmatriks

Penampil Dotmatriks (3)Ditulis oleh Shato pada 5 February 2009Tidak ada komentarItem ini ditulis di dalam Application ShareThis

Driver Dotmatrik

Kemampuan transistor jenis NPN yang digunakan untuk men-driver dotmatriks harus mampu mengalirkan arus sebesar kemampuan maksimal dari kebutuhan dotmatriks. Sehingga transistor yang digunakan harus mampu mengalirkan arus diatas 120 mA.

Karena semakin berkembangnya teknologi terintegrasi maka transistor yang berfungsi khusus untuk mendriver sebuah beban yang terkontrol dan dapat untuk menangani/mengalirkan arus sebesar 500mA sudah tersedia di dalam sebuah rangkaian terintegrasi ULN2803.

ULN2803 adalah IC yang didalamnya merupakan susunan transistor yang terpasang secara darlington dan dapat menangani arus sebesar 500 mA,dan didalam ULN2803 ini terdapat delapan buah susunan darlington yang dapat bekerja secara individu sehingga beban yang dapat dipasang pada ULN2803 ini sebanyak 8 buah. hal ini sesuai diaplikasikan untuk men-driver dotmatriks yang dikendalikan oleh mikrokontroler.

Gambar dibawah memperlihatkan susunan rangkaian dari driver untuk dotmatriks dalam satu kolomnya. Pengambilan daya pada kolom diambil dari 74LS245 yang diteruskan oleh ULN2803 sehingga konfigurasi semacam ini tidak memberatkan beban arus bagi mikrokontroler dan mikrokontroler sebagai pengendali saja. 74LS245 selain sebagai pengunci dalam hal ini juga bertugas sebagai penyedia arus bagi satu titik pada susunan dotmatriks.

Page 2: 3. Penampil Dotmatriks

Gambar Susunan Driver dan Kendali kolom dotmatriks

Persambungan Dotmatriks 8×8 titik 8 Buah

Dengan mengetahui karakteristik-karakteristik rangkaian yang diperlukan, maka dapat disusun menjadi rangkaian pengendali tampilan dotmatriks seperti pada Gambar

Page 3: 3. Penampil Dotmatriks

Gambar Pengendali Dotmatriks 8×8 titik

Jalur Baris dihubungkan ke saluran antarmuka 8 Bit mikrokontroler yaitu Port.0, dengan melalui driver ULN2803 terlebih dahulu sebelum langsung terhubung ke mikrokontroler, begitu juga apabila digunakan 8 Buah dotmatriks, jalur baris semuanya dari 8 dotmatriks dihubungkan ke Port.0 ( dari P0.0 sampai P0.7).

Resistor yang dipasang pada setiap port.0 ini berfungsi sebagai pull up eksternal, dimana kaki port.0 ini sering digunakan sebagai pengakses memori eksternal, kaki port.0 ini tidak dilengkapi dengan pullup internal, sehingga untuk menghindari pengambangan logika maka diberi pull up eksternal pada setiap kaki port.0 ( dari P0.0 sampai P0.7).

Jalur kolom dihubungkan ke kaki IC pengunci/74xx245 pada sisi B dan pada kaki sisi A dihubungkan ke kaki mikrokontrol. Kedelapan dotmatriks dipasang jalur seperti pada gambar diatas, dan pada sisi setiap kaki A 74XX245 dihubungkan ke mikrokontroler.

Pengendali jalur kolom ini yaitu 74xx245 dihubungkan ke kaki Port.2, pada kaki kontrol hal ini hanya memerlukan satu kontrol dari setiap do dotmatriks-nya, apabila digunakan 8 dotmatriks, maka diperlukan 8 antarmuka mikrokontroler.

Untuk persambungan dapat dilihat pada Tabel

Tabel Persambungan Mikrokontroler Dengan 8 buah Dotmatriks

Page 4: 3. Penampil Dotmatriks

Mikrokontrol AT89S51 Hubungan

Port Pin

PORT 0

P0.0 Baris 0

P0.1 Baris 1P0.2 Baris 2P0.3 Baris 3P0.4 Baris 4P0.5 Baris 5P0.6 Baris 6P0.7 Baris 7

PORT 2

P2.0 Matrix 1

P2.1 Matrix 2P2.2 Matrix 3P2.3 Matrix 4P2.4 Matrix 5P2.5 Matrix 6P2.6 Matrix 7P2.7 Matrix 8

PORT 3

P3.0 A 0

P3.1 A 1P3.2 A 2P3.3 A 3P3.4 A 4P3.5 A 5P3.6 A 6P3.7 A 7

SELANJUTNYA…..